• CIT Northbridge Credit Refinances and Upsizes $45 Million Credit Facility with Tubular Synergy
    May 22, 2023

    First Citizens Bank today announced that CIT Northbridge Credit, as advised by CIT Asset Management LLC, has provided $45 million to refinance and upsize a secured credit facility for Tubular Synergy Group LP, a privately held sales, marketing and supply chain services distributor.

    Founded in 2008 and headquartered in Dallas, Texas, Tubular Synergy Group provides casing, tubing, and line pipe products for the energy industry.

  • KKR Taps Pietrzak as Sole Global Head of Private Credit
    May 22, 2023

    Daniel Pietrzak, a partner at KKR & Co., has been named the alternative money manager's sole global head of private credit, a spokeswoman said in an email Friday. Mr. Pietrzak was named the sole global head following the departure of fellow partner and co-head of private credit Matthieu Boulanger to pursue other opportunities, the spokeswoman said.

  • MidCap Financial Closes $325mm Senior Revolving Credit Facility to Revlon
    May 16, 2023
    MidCap Financial, a leading commercial finance company focused on middle market transactions, today announced it has provided a $325mm senior revolving credit facility to Revlon Intermediate Holdings IV LLC. (“Revlon” or “Company”) in connection with Revlon’s successful emergence from Chapter 11.  
  • Vice Media Files for Bankruptcy
    May 15, 2023
    Vice will enter into a purchasing agreement with a number of its vendors to try and stay afloat, according to a filing in New York federal court. The group, led by Fortress Investment Group, Soros Fund Management, and Monroe Capital, will purchase Vice's assets for $225 million and take on liabilities as high as $1 billion, the filing said.
  • TPG to Acquire Angelo Gordon
    May 15, 2023
    TPG Inc. (NASDAQ: TPG), a leading global alternative asset management firm, and Angelo Gordon, a $73 billion1,2 alternative investment firm focused on credit and real estate investing, today announced that the companies have entered into a definitive agreement under which TPG will acquire Angelo Gordon in a cash and equity transaction valued at approximately $2.7 billion, based on TPG Inc.’s share price as of May 12, 2023, including an estimated $970 million in cash and up to 62.5 million common units of the TPG Operating Group and restricted stock units of TPG, in each case, subject to certain adjustments.

  • Legacy Corporate Lending, New Asset-based Lending Company, Launches With Investment From Bain Capital Credit
    May 10, 2023
    Legacy Corporate Lending (“Legacy”) a new asset-based lending (ABL) company, today announced its launch as an independent lender focused on serving the needs of middle market companies across North America. Legacy is launching with a significant equity investment from funds managed by a subsidiary of Bain Capital Credit, L.P., (“Bain Capital Credit”), a leading global credit specialist.
